Infiniti has the master key, so should Nissan and will remove the locks for you and put a new set on for $65. My dealer was $56. They are OEM from McGard, but you need the number of the key. Check the owners manual for a business size card with the numbers on it for McGard and call and order a new key. $14.99 shipped. If you dont have the card, you will just have to have the dealer remove the locks and put on your own or pay for theirs.
